What to know about Manhattanhenge, NYC’s sunset spectacle
New York City residents and visitors are treated to a phenomenon twice a year known as Manhattanhenge, when the setting sun aligns with the Manhattan street grid and sinks below the horizon framed in a canyon of skyscrapers.

After Longview implosion, doctors explain severity of chemical burns
The implosion exposed people to white liquor, a caustic chemical used to break down wood into pulp that is similar to a "really concentrated bleach," one doctor said.

Details emerge of complex cleanup effort after deadly Longview tank implosion
The implosion released hundreds of thousands of gallons of a caustic, high pH liquid into a drainage system. The cleanup is ongoing and complex.
